Output f85814826c371ff201d89e6fbc60ac7155feaac1613d81b7aca04df9bc60aa72:1

value
575735
script pubkey
OP_0 OP_PUSHBYTES_20 385b24fe624a78d30296293cd665052a441bc5e3
address
bc1q8pdjflnzffudxq5k9y7dveg99fzph30rcv9h3a
transaction
f85814826c371ff201d89e6fbc60ac7155feaac1613d81b7aca04df9bc60aa72
confirmations
339250
spent
true